An exciting opportunity has arisen to lead our well established and respected Young People’s Service (YPS). The YPS is available to children and young people across the city of Leeds.

This service supports children and young people up to 18 years old who are bereaved of a significant person through a palliative illness. The service also supports families in preparing for a death by offering safe and supportive conversations, often involving exploring feelings through art, play and active listening.

This is an excellent opportunity for a qualified and experienced professional with strong leadership skills and a passion for youth engagement to join our team.

As the Coordinator for the Young People’s Service, you will be expected to:

* Be an experienced practitioner working within the children’s sector (such as in health, mental health, social care, counselling, education etc).
* Have experience and understanding of pre and post bereavement needs of children, young people and their families.
* Be able to sit with distress, whilst also having proven skills to manage your own wellbeing.
* Lead on all children and young people safeguarding concerns that arise within YPS and the wider St Gemma’s services.
* Coordinate and deliver both group and 1:1 support for children and young people and their families.
* Line manage staff, students and volunteers in the YPS service, offering supervision, support and training.
* Ensure a commitment to equality, diversity and inclusion.
* Promote and deliver meaningful children and young person’s participation in shaping and improving our services.
